DeepSeek带来的Deepshock:技术跃迁与开发者生态的全面重构
2025.09.15 11:41浏览量:0简介:本文深度解析DeepSeek技术架构的核心突破,揭示其引发的"Deepshock"现象本质,从算法创新、工程优化到生态影响进行系统性拆解,为开发者提供技术选型与架构升级的实操指南。
一、Deepshock现象:技术范式转换引发的行业震荡
DeepSeek的横空出世并非单纯的技术迭代,而是引发了AI开发领域的”Deepshock”——一种由底层技术范式转换带来的系统性冲击。这种冲击体现在三个维度:
- 算法效率的指数级跃迁
DeepSeek-V3模型通过动态稀疏注意力机制,将传统Transformer架构的O(n²)复杂度降至O(n log n)。实测数据显示,在处理10万token序列时,推理速度提升3.2倍,内存占用降低58%。这种效率突破直接动摇了”算力换精度”的行业共识。 - 开发门槛的断层式下降
其创新的模块化设计允许开发者通过配置文件调整模型行为,无需修改核心代码。例如,通过修改attention_pattern.json
即可切换局部/全局注意力模式,使中小团队也能快速定制专业领域模型。 - 生态系统的重构效应
DeepSeek开源社区已涌现237个衍生项目,涵盖医疗诊断、金融风控等垂直领域。这种自下而上的创新生态,正在改写AI技术供应的权力结构。
二、技术内核解构:三大突破点解析
1. 动态稀疏注意力机制
class DynamicSparseAttention(nn.Module):
def __init__(self, dim, num_heads, sparsity=0.7):
super().__init__()
self.sparsity = sparsity # 动态稀疏率
self.topk = int((1-sparsity)*dim)
def forward(self, x):
# 计算全局注意力分数
scores = x @ x.transpose(-2, -1) # [batch, heads, seq, seq]
# 动态选择top-k连接
mask = torch.zeros_like(scores)
for i in range(scores.size(0)):
for j in range(scores.size(1)):
flat_scores = scores[i,j].flatten()
topk_indices = flat_scores.topk(self.topk).indices
k = torch.arange(scores.size(-1)).repeat(scores.size(-2),1)
q = torch.arange(scores.size(-2)).unsqueeze(-1).expand(-1,scores.size(-1))
mask[i,j,q.flatten(),k.flatten()] = 1
# 应用稀疏掩码
return scores * mask
该实现通过动态选择注意力连接,在保持长序列处理能力的同时,将计算量降低70%。实际测试中,在WMT14英德翻译任务上,BLEU值仅下降0.8个点。
2. 混合精度量化方案
DeepSeek采用FP8+INT4的混合量化策略,在NVIDIA A100上实现:
- 激活值:FP8动态范围量化(误差<0.3%)
- 权重:INT4静态量化(需校准数据集)
- 梯度:FP16反向传播
这种设计使模型大小缩减至1/8,而推理吞吐量提升2.4倍。某电商平台的实测数据显示,其推荐系统响应时间从120ms降至48ms,转化率提升1.7%。
3. 自适应计算优化
通过嵌入的ComputingProfiler
模块,DeepSeek可实时监测:
- GPU利用率(SM占用率)
- 内存带宽压力
- 计算/通信重叠比
动态调整策略包括:
def adjust_batch_size(profiler):
if profiler.sm_occupancy < 0.7:
return min(current_batch * 1.5, max_batch)
elif profiler.mem_bandwidth > 0.9:
return max(current_batch * 0.8, min_batch)
return current_batch
这种自适应机制使资源利用率稳定在85%以上,较固定配置方案提升40%效率。
三、开发者应对策略
1. 技术选型矩阵
场景 | 推荐方案 | 迁移成本 | 收益周期 |
---|---|---|---|
实时推理服务 | DeepSeek-Lite + FP8量化 | 低 | 1个月 |
长序列处理 | 动态稀疏注意力+注意力缓存 | 中 | 3个月 |
移动端部署 | DeepSeek-Mobile + INT4量化 | 高 | 6个月 |
2. 架构升级路线图
评估阶段(1-2周)
- 使用
DeepSeek-Benchmark
工具包进行性能基线测试 - 识别现有系统的计算瓶颈点
- 使用
迁移阶段(3-6周)
- 逐步替换注意力层为动态稀疏版本
- 实施混合精度训练流程
优化阶段(持续)
- 构建自适应计算监控面板
- 参与开源社区贡献定制算子
3. 风险防控要点
- 量化误差补偿:建立校准数据集持续更新量化参数
- 稀疏模式验证:通过
attention_visualizer
检查连接合理性 - 回滚机制:保留原始模型作为故障恢复选项
四、未来技术演进方向
- 硬件协同设计:与芯片厂商合作开发定制化稀疏计算单元
- 动态神经架构:实现运行时模型结构自动调整
- 多模态融合:集成视觉、语音等模态的动态注意力机制
DeepSeek引发的Deepshock正在重塑AI开发的技术边界。对于开发者而言,这既是挑战更是机遇——那些能率先掌握动态稀疏计算、混合精度量化等核心技术的团队,将在下一轮AI竞赛中占据战略制高点。建议开发者立即启动技术评估,制定分阶段的迁移计划,同时积极参与开源生态建设,共同推动行业技术标准的形成。
发表评论
登录后可评论,请前往 登录 或 注册